In a move that highlights the growing global footprint of professional wrestling, current Undisputed WWE Champion Cody Rhodes has extended his reach far beyond the bright lights of the television arena. Soft Ground Wrestling (SGW), a grassroots promotion based in Uganda, recently announced that the wrestling superstar personally purchased and donated a professional-grade wrestling ring to their organization. The gesture provides a significant infrastructure upgrade for the promotion, which has become a viral sensation for its resourceful, high-energy matches often held in outdoor, makeshift environments.
The contribution of a standard ring is a transformative development for SGW, an organization that has garnered international attention for its commitment to the sport despite significant logistical hurdles. By providing a stable, professional training environment, Rhodes is directly supporting the development of local talent in East Africa. The promotion confirmed the arrival of the equipment through their official social media channels, expressing gratitude for the support as they continue to build their brand and provide opportunities for the next generation of wrestlers.

Rhodes Focuses on Title Defense at Clash in Italy
While his philanthropic efforts have made waves, Cody Rhodes remains locked in a high-stakes professional campaign. As the reigning Undisputed WWE Champion, he is scheduled to defend his title against Gunther at the highly anticipated Clash in Italy. The event is set to be held at the Inalpi Arena in Turin, marking a significant stop for the promotion as it continues its aggressive international expansion strategy, which has seen recent record-breaking events in various global markets according to official WWE scheduling.

For fans looking to follow the action, the event features a unique broadcast structure. The opening hour is slated to be available for free on ESPN’s linear channel, while the full event will be accessible to subscribers via ESPN Unlimited. International audiences, meanwhile, can tune in to the live broadcast on Netflix, reflecting the ongoing transition of wrestling content to major streaming platforms as part of the multi-year media rights agreement. The event is scheduled to commence at 2:00 p.m. ET / 11:00 a.m. PT.
